Nawab Ganj

Nawab Ganj is a village located in Chhabra tehsil of Baran district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Chhabra (tehsildar office) and 75km away from district headquarter Baran. As per 2009 stats, Kadaiya Nohar is the gram panchayat of Nawab Ganj village.

About Nawab Ganj

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Nawab Ganj is 103519. The village spans a total geographical area of 326.27 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 325220. Chhabra is nearest town to Nawab Ganj village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Nawab Ganj

Below is a concise population overview of Nawab Ganj as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 783 398 385
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 199 104 95
Scheduled Castes (SC) 1 1 N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 779 397 382
Literate Population 232 133 99
Illiterate Population 551 265 286

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Nawab Ganj village:

  • The total population of Nawab Ganj village is around 783, including approximately 398 males and 385 females, with a sex ratio of 967 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 199 children aged 0–6 years in Nawab Ganj village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Nawab Ganj village has 1 person bel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 779 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Nawab Ganj village is about 29.63%, with male literacy at 33.42% and female literacy at 25.71%.
  • There are around 149 households in Nawab Ganj village.

Connectivity of Nawab Ganj

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Nawab Ganj. As per the 2011 stats, Nawab Ganj had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
